Homemade jam

Necessary costs: from 7-8 thousand rubles.

For such production, additional equipment may not be required. For normal operation, you need: pots, jars with lids of different sizes (preferably small, since it will be easier to sell them), a seaming machine. As for raw materials, then you can go in two ways: either buy products in stores or markets, or take everything you need from your own garden. It should be noted that the profitability of such a business in winter is about 30%. But selling jam in the summer is less profitable. Therefore, the workpieces made in the summer can be held until winter and sold at a better price.

When we talk about paper crafts, a word familiar to everyone involuntarily arises in our head. The word "origami". Origami is the art of making from paper blanks various crafts... Many famous cranes, which according to legend can fulfill any desire, have won the hearts of all origami lovers. They say that if you add one thousand cranes, then you can make a wish that will come true. So what can you do with your own hands out of paper?

Do you know what kusudama is and can you make it yourself from paper? If not, then here is our answer. Kusudama is an origami made up of several crafts. It is also called modular origami... Many admirers of ancient origami traditions do not consider kusudama to be real origami. The fact is that origami uses only the properties of paper. Kusudama involves the use of multiple origami crafts, thread, scissors, glue, and so on. Kusudama can take much longer than origami. From the outside of the kusudama is volumetric sphere folded from several origami shapes. As a rule, these are various kinds of flowers. These modules are folded separately and held together with thread or glue. There are kusudams, which, due to their complex structure, are fastened to each other without the help of glue or threads. At its core, kusudama is a "medicine ball", since the word itself consists of two - "kusuri" (medicine) and "tama" (ball). In the culture and life of Ancient Japan, such balls were hung over the bed of a sick person and they believed that healing would come thanks to kusudama. In our time, kusudama can be used as an interior detail or a gift to a friend or loved one. Try to put together a simple Triple Pancake Kusudama using the video below:

Quilling is the art of creating compositions from twisted into spirals colorful stripes paper. Using this technique, you can create postcards, paintings, jewelry, photo frames, and even volumetric decorations for the interior.


It is noteworthy that this hobby does not require spending a lot of money on the purchase of consumables (except for strips of colored paper, you will need glue, scissors, tweezers and special device for twisting tapes). It is not difficult to master the quilling technique, but it will take a lot of time, patience and especially perseverance to create truly unique pieces.

All products made using paper rolling consist of basic elements (modules), such as a tight and free spiral, curl, triangle, square, heart, eye, leaf and others. To quickly understand how to do them, you should carefully consider the photos of the modules or several videos with quilling master classes.

Decoupage is the name of a decorating technique, which consists in attaching a pattern to an object and coating the resulting product with varnish. In this case, the product looks as if the picture was originally drawn on it. In this way, you can decorate not only surfaces made of glass, plastic, ceramics or wood, but also leather or fabric.


For decoupage, you will need an object to which you need to transfer the drawing (it can be a vase, a cutting board, a chair or even a whole cabinet), glue, scissors, varnish and the picture itself (shown on a napkin or cut from a magazine). The surface of the object to be decorated must be thoroughly cleaned from dirt and degreased. The picture is cut out with scissors, on its reverse side glue is applied, then it is placed on the surface of the product. After the glue dries, the item is covered with clear varnish.

Scrapbooking is the design of photo albums. For this are used family photos, drawings, newspaper clippings and notes. On each sheet of such a photo album, a collage is placed that expresses a certain thought or covers certain events in life. whole family: wedding day, birthday, family vacation, etc.


Since digital photographs, which can be stored almost forever on special media, have become firmly established in our lives, paper photo albums have begun to recede into the past. But at the same time scrapbooking simply moved into a new quality: various computer applications appeared that allow you to process photos, insert them into various frames, make collages from them, put various signatures, audio and video files in them.

Felting is wool felting. With this technique, you can do very original jewelry and beautiful toys, slippers, bags, scarves. To master similar method You will need non-spun wool of various colors and special needles for felting.


Anyone can master felting. To make a bulky product, wool is placed on foam rubber, which is then entangled with needles. Needles are applied first big size, then, as the product becomes denser, they are replaced with thinner ones. Crafting from non-spun wool is very fascinating activity which brings real pleasure.

Patchwork is a technique in which a canvas with a unique pattern is created from patches. Blankets, bags, rugs, toys and panels are made using this technique. To create a work of art using the patchwork technique, you will need scraps of fabric, scissors, a ruler and thread.


Patchwork cutting is done using patterns that are simple geometric shapes. The assembly of the product is made from small parts to larger ones. There are so many successful schemes, when using which novice needlewomen can create unique works. Once you have mastered the basics of patchwork, you can start developing your own schemes.

Fusing is a technology that allows you to make real stained glass windows and exclusive decorations at home. For this, special furnaces are used, in which glass is sintered at a temperature of about a thousand degrees.


To create an original product, you will need multi-colored glasses, goggles, glass granules, a glass cutter, special gloves, and heat-resistant paper. First, a sketch of the future product is invented and drawn, then glass is cut. A mosaic of cut multicolored glass is laid out on thermal paper, and the gaps between the glasses are filled with granules. The resulting pattern is placed in an oven and baked at a very high temperature.

Important: after the end of baking, you need to wait a few hours until the product has completely cooled down.

DIY crafts (photo). We print with leaves.


You can leave prints of leaves on paper or clothing (if you use special paint for fabrics) and create beautiful, bright and original designs.


This may take a bit of practice as there are several paint application techniques and the result depends on the type and quality of paint and paper you are using.

You can also involve children.

You will need:

Fresh Leaves - Collect with the children as part of the craftwork process

Brush, sponge or roller

Paint or ink - best applied with a roller

* Try experimenting on paper first before deciding to apply designs to fabric.

We use paint

Using a brush, sponge or roller, apply paint to the leaf. You can put a sheet of paper on top or vice versa, turn the leaf over and attach it to the paper. The main thing is to find the right amount of paint.

We use ink

Apply some ink to a leaf and place it gently on the paper. Cover the top of the sheet with paper and press down gently to transfer the colors onto the bottom paper.

* You can put a towel under the paper to translate more details.

Crafts for the garden and garden with their own hands. Wooden vase.


This craft is very simple to do, you can safely attract children who will gladly take part in the project.

You will need:

Sticks and twigs

Empty coffee can

Saw or knife (to cut the sticks neatly)

Dark paper

1. To get started, collect a few sticks on the street.

2. Prepare a can of coffee or cocoa (you can use another container)


3. Trim all of your sticks to about the same size. They should also be a couple of centimeters taller than the coffee can.


* Some sticks can simply be broken gently, without the use of sharp objects.

4. Wrap the jar in dark paper and secure it with glue. This is done so that unnecessary drawings on the container are not visible.


5. Start gluing the sticks to the paper that wraps the jar. It will be easier if the sticks are more or less even. You can also make it easier for yourself by using thin sticks in places with large openings.


* Make sure the bottom of the sticks are level so that your vase is firm and not wobbly.

6. It remains to add decorative or real long twigs and artificial flowers and the composition is ready. You can decorate your garden or home with this craft.
